Understanding Support: Is a Sports Bra Good for Heavy Breasts?
You might wonder why some bras feel like a gentle hug while others feel like a straightjacket. The science behind it is pretty cool; but it is also a bit scary if you are not wearing the right gear. For those of us with a bigger bust, the question is not just about fashion. We need to know: is sports bra good for heavy breast health? The answer is a loud yes.
Inside our breasts, we have thin tissues called Cooper’s ligaments. Think of them like tiny, delicate rubber bands that hold everything in place. Here is the catch; once these ligaments stretch out, they do not bounce back. This is why a heavy duty sports bra for large breasts is so important. Without proper support, high-impact movement can lead to permanent sagging and chronic back pain.
Research from the University of Portsmouth shows that breasts move in a figure-eight pattern. This is not just up and down; it is also side to side and in and out. During a run, breasts can move over 15 centimeters. That is a lot of stress on your skin and ligaments. If you do not have a maximum support sports bra for large breasts, your body actually tries to compensate. You might take shorter strides or move your arms differently. This makes your workout feel much harder than it actually is.
Many women worry about the look of these bras. They ask, do sports bras flatten your chest? The answer depends on the type of bra you choose. There are two main ways to handle bounce: compression and encapsulation.
Pro Insight: Why Encapsulation is Non-Negotiable for Large Breasts
While compression bras (the ones you pull over your head) work for smaller cups, they often fail for D+ sizes. Encapsulation is different. It uses individual cups to support each breast separately. This prevents the breasts from rubbing together and stops that “unibrow” look while providing way better bounce control.
Compression bras basically squash everything against your ribs. This can make you look flat; and for very heavy breasts, it often does not stop the movement. It just moves the bounce to a different spot. On the other hand, encapsulation vs compression for large busts is a clear win for encapsulation. By surrounding each breast in its own cup, the bra can stop movement from every direction. Finding what is the most supportive sports bra for large breasts usually means looking for this cup-based design. It protects your tissue during HIIT or running while letting you keep a natural shape. Plus, it keeps things much cooler and less sweaty between the girls.

From Our Experience: The ‘Two-Finger’ Test for Underband Tightness
To see if your bra fits right, try the two-finger test. You should be able to slide exactly two fingers under the back band. If you can fit more, it is too loose. If you can’t fit any, it is too tight. Proper band tightness provides 80% of your total support!

Shock Absorber Ultimate Run Bra: Extreme Bounce Control
If you want a bra that feels like a fortress but does not use wires, the Shock Absorber Ultimate Run Bra is for you. It’s often called a maximum support sports bra for large breasts because it uses a special ‘Infinity-8’ system. This design stops the figure-eight movement that happens when you run. During my tests, I focused on the real-world sweat-wicking performance of the Shock Absorber band; even after a long, humid run, the band stayed dry and didn’t chafe my skin.
Is sports bra good for heavy breast health if it does not have metal wires? Yes; if the design is right. This bra is a heavy duty sports bra for large breasts that relies on clever fabric layers instead of underwires. But here is the catch; the band is very tight. Many women find they need to “sister size up” to breathe properly. Basically, if you usually wear a 34G, you might need a 36F in this brand. Shefit Ultimate Sports Bra: Customizable Stability
If you have ever felt like your bra is too tight on your shoulders but loose on your ribs, you need to try the Shefit Ultimate Sports Bra. This is a very heavy duty sports bra for large breasts because of how much you can change the fit. It uses 2-inch wide Velcro straps on both the shoulders and the rib band. This makes it a great choice for women with different bust-to-waist ratios; you can tighten the bottom for support and adjust the top for comfort.
I put this bra through a tough CrossFit workout last Tuesday. During burpees and fast sprints, I didn’t have to stop once to fix my gear. Elomi Energise High Impact: Best for Full Figures (Up to K Cup)
The Elomi Energise High Impact Sports Bra is a total lifesaver for women who need a heavy duty sports bra for large breasts. It goes all the way up to a UK K cup; which is a huge help if you usually struggle to find your size in standard stores. One big problem with big busts is strap slippage. If you have narrow shoulders, those wide straps often slide right off your arms during a workout.
This bra fixes that with a special J-hook on the back. When you click it together, it turns the bra into a racerback. This gives you extra lift and keeps everything secure while you move. Many women wonder, is sports bra good for heavy breast support if you have a very full figure? Elomi uses high-quality microfiber fabric that handles high friction without wearing out. It stays strong even after many trips to the gym and lots of washing.
Expert Tip: How to adjust the J-hook for instant strap relief
If you feel the weight pulling on your shoulders, slide the J-hook together on the back. This turns it into a racerback. It shifts the weight toward your center and stops straps from falling down your arms during a workout.

The Technical Fit Guide: How to Spot a Performance Failure Before You Buy
So, you bought a heavy duty sports bra for large breasts but you are still bouncing? That is really frustrating. I have spent hundreds of hours testing these; and most failures happen because of three simple things. Let’s break them down so you do not waste money on gear that does not work.
The ‘Band Rule’
The most common mistake is relying on the straps. Here is the deal: 80% of your support must come from the band around your ribs. If your band is too big, it slides up your back. When that happens, the weight of your chest pulls the straps into your shoulders. This leads to deep red marks and neck pain.
Women often ask, is sports bra good for heavy breast support if it feels very tight? Yes; it needs to be snug to work. In 2026, we still see high return rates because shoppers choose bands that are too loose. Just keep in mind, the band is the foundation. If it fails, the whole bra fails.
Troubleshooting the ‘Quad-Boob’
If you see your chest spilling over the top of the cups, you have a “quad-boob” problem. This is a clear sign your cup size is too small. Even a maximum support sports bra for large breasts won’t work if the cups are too tiny. When the cup is too small, the fabric cannot hold the tissue. This causes more movement and can even lead to skin rashes. You might wonder, do sports bras flatten your chest when they are too small? Yes; they might squash you. But they won’t stop the bounce or give you a nice shape.
The Straps: Adjustment is Key
We often think wide straps are the only answer. While padding helps, the adjustment range matters more. Some bras have straps that are too long even at their tightest setting. This is a big deal. Research from the University of Portsmouth shows that vertical movement is the biggest challenge for D+ cups. If you cannot tighten your straps enough, you won’t get that “lift.” When looking for what is the most supportive sports bra for large breasts, check if the straps can be adjusted to your height.
Making It Last: Longevity and Care for Heavy Duty Bras
A good high impact sports bra for D+ cups is a big investment. You want it to stay strong for a long time. In my experience, even the best heavy duty sports bra for large breasts starts to get tired if you do not treat it right.
After 30+ wash cycles with my favorite bras, I’ve noticed that the bands stay much firmer if you air dry them. Always wash your bras in cold water; and never put them in the dryer. The high heat breaks down the elastic. This makes the band stretch out, which means you lose that important support. If you treat your bra well, it should keep its bounce control technology 2026 for at least six to nine months of heavy use.
